Lawrence “Toehead” Campbell, Chillicothe, passed away on Monday, January 26, 2022, following a long illness. Toehead, the second oldest son of the late William and Elma (Skaggs) Campbell is proceeded in death by his parents, the love of his life, Ms. Jeanette Lorain Menges, brothers John Lee and Ralph and sisters Thelma and Ida.
Toehead is survived by his daughter, Miranda Dunham, Utica, New York, her children Taylor Smith of Chillicothe, Zachary and Brooke Ward and Justin, Sienna, Gabriella, and Gavin Dunham. He also is survived by four great-grandchildren, Malachi, Joshua, and Emma Jo Ward and Maryn Smith. Lastly, he is survived by his siblings, their spouses, two sister-in laws and numerous nieces and nephews: brothers Ovid (Mary) Campbell, Bill (Connie) Campbell, sisters Sue (Garry) Graves, Debbie Campbell, Laverne (Ronnie) Dotson, Jeanette Campbell, and sister-in-laws Molly Campbell and Judy Campbell.
Toehead was employed as a heavy-machine equipment operator until injury forced him into retirement and he resided in Pottsville, Pennsylvania for a large portion of his adult life. He was a big man with a big heart and a fan of the Ohio State Buckeyes. The family would like to express a special thank you to Robie Campbell for her caring and perseverance.
Funeral services will be held at 1:00 p.m., Tuesday, February 1, 2022 at the FAWCETT OLIVER GLASS AND PALMER FUNERAL HOME, Chillicothe. Burial will follow in Londonderry Cemetery. Friends may call at the funeral home from 12:00 pm until the hour of service on Tuesday. The family will receive those who attend at the Londonderry Cemetery Church following the committal service.
